如何配置IIS以重定向到站点

时间:2018-04-13 23:56:49

标签: asp.net iis dns coldfusion

到目前为止,我在Windows机器上下载并配置了IIS(版本10)。我使用hosts文件创建了一个名为kinux的域,因此当我导航到kinux.com时,我将被带到我的IIS服务器根目录。然后,我创建了一个名为localwww的站点,并将ColdFusion配置为通过此站点运行。

我要做的就是这样做,以便当我转到kinux.com时,它会将我重定向到我的ColdFusion网站。有谁知道如何做到这一点?

主机

# Copyright (c) 1993-2009 Microsoft Corp.
#
# This is a sample HOSTS file used by Microsoft TCP/IP for Windows.
#
# localhost name resolution is handled within DNS itself.
#   127.0.0.1       localhost
#   ::1             localhost

127.0.0.1       Kinux
127.0.0.1       Kinux.com

localwww网站 iis

默认网站 DESKTOP-SERVER

1 个答案:

答案 0 :(得分:1)

我能想到的两个解决方案:

  1. 将ColdFusion站点移至端口80,并为主机名" kinux.com"添加绑定这样所有对kinux.com的传入请求都将由您的ColdFusion站点提供。

  2. 假设"桌面服务器"是您输入" kinux.com时调用的网站,在IIS管理器中单击它。在中心面板中,您将找到" HTTP重定向"。在此处设置ColdFusion网站的URL。现在会发生什么请求进入"桌面服务器"网站将被重定向到您的冷聚变网站。

  3. 在解决方案2中,需要注意的重要一点是第一个请求何时到达"桌面服务器"站点,IIS将向客户端(访问它的浏览器)指示已将重定向规则设置为新URL。客户端现在将再次向新地址(ColdFusion)发出新请求。因此,请确保客户端计算机也可以访问您在HTTP重定向规则中输入的URL。

    如果您有任何疑问,请与我们联系。